Root Drench Range

The instructions provide a range for root drench on shrubs of 26-48 cumaltive shrub height. Why is their a range? Does the lower range (26') indicate a higher dosage? Would you apply a higher dosage for specific insects?

Answer:

The manufacturers of most product allow a range of usage rates so that applicators can choose to use a higher usage rate for hardier insects (whitefly, boring beetles) and for a longer lasting residual. You can use the lower usage rate for easier to kill insects or when a shorter residual is desired.
